Barn construction services involve designing, planning, and building sturdy, functional structures to serve a variety of purposes on rural or semi-rural properties. These services typically include framing, foundation work, wall assembly, roofing, and finishing touches necessary to create a durable and reliable barn. Contractors may also assist with customizing the design to meet specific needs, whether for livestock shelter, equipment storage, or additional workspace. The goal is to provide a structure that withstands local weather conditions and offers long-term utility for property owners.
One of the primary problems barn construction services help address is the need for secure, weather-resistant storage solutions. Many property owners struggle with storing equipment, feed, or livestock in structures that are either inadequate or deteriorate over time. Professional barn builders address these issues by constructing robust frameworks that prevent water intrusion, pest entry, and structural damage. Additionally, they can incorporate features such as ventilation, insulation, and access points to improve functionality and comfort within the barn.

Material Costs - The cost of materials for barn construction typically ranges from $10,000 to $30,000, depending on size and quality. For example, a standard 24x36-foot barn might cost around $15,000 in materials alone.
Labor Expenses - Labor costs can vary between $20 to $50 per hour, totaling approximately $5,000 to $15,000 for a standard project. Larger or more complex barns may incur higher labor fees.
Design and Permitting - Design and permitting fees generally fall between $1,000 and $5,000, influenced by local regulations and the project's complexity. Custom designs tend to increase overall costs.
Additional Features - Adding features such as stalls, lofts, or insulation can increase the total cost by $5,000 to $20,000. These enhancements depend on specific project requirements and choices.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

When evaluating barn construction professionals, it is important to consider their experience in building structures similar to the project at hand. Reputable contractors typically have a history of completing barn projects in the local area, which can be an indicator of their familiarity with regional building codes, climate considerations, and common design preferences. Homeowners may wish to review portfolios or ask for examples of past work to gauge the scope and quality of a contractor’s experience, ensuring that their expertise aligns with the specific needs of the barn project.
Clear written expectations are essential for a smooth construction process. Homeowners should seek out professionals who provide detailed proposals that outline the scope of work, materials to be used, project milestones, and approximate timelines. Having these expectations documented helps prevent misunderstandings and provides a reference point throughout the project. It is advisable to compare multiple contractors to see how thoroughly they communicate project details and whether their written plans match the homeowner’s vision and requirements.
